So, 'Satnam Shri Waheguru' is this tranquil piece that really immerses you in the spiritual ambiance. The soothing simran of the Shabad 'Satnam Sri Waheguru' performed by Jagjit Singh is almost ethereal, right? It’s less about narrative and more about the experience, where the repetition of the mantra creates this meditative state. The performance itself feels intimate, with Singh’s voice guiding you through, almost like a personal prayer. The simplicity of the visuals complements the auditory focus, creating a serene atmosphere that really allows the viewer to connect with the mantra on a deeper level. It's not flashy but has this unique charm and depth for those who appreciate devotional music and spiritual reflection.
